当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

一台服务器如何搭建多个网站,深入解析,一台服务器如何高效搭建多个网站

一台服务器如何搭建多个网站,深入解析,一台服务器如何高效搭建多个网站

一台服务器高效搭建多个网站的关键在于合理配置虚拟主机。通过合理分配资源,实现资源共享,优化网站性能。详细解析虚拟主机搭建步骤,包括环境配置、域名解析、网站部署等,助您轻...

一台服务器高效搭建多个网站的关键在于合理配置虚拟主机。通过合理分配资源,实现资源共享,优化网站性能。详细解析虚拟主机搭建步骤,包括环境配置、域名解析、网站部署等,助您轻松搭建多站集群。

随着互联网的飞速发展,网站已经成为企业、个人展示形象、拓展业务的重要平台,对于企业而言,搭建多个网站可以满足不同业务需求,提高品牌知名度,服务器资源有限,如何在同一台服务器下搭建多个网站成为许多网站管理员关心的问题,本文将深入解析如何在同一台服务器下搭建多个网站,希望对大家有所帮助。

一台服务器如何搭建多个网站,深入解析,一台服务器如何高效搭建多个网站

搭建多个网站的前提条件

1、服务器性能:服务器性能要满足搭建多个网站的需求,包括CPU、内存、硬盘等硬件资源。

2、操作系统:建议选择稳定、安全的操作系统,如Linux。

3、域名:为每个网站购买一个独立域名。

4、网络带宽:确保服务器网络带宽充足,以满足访问量大的需求。

5、数据库:根据网站需求选择合适的数据库,如MySQL、Oracle等。

搭建多个网站的方法

1、虚拟主机(VPS)

虚拟主机是将一台物理服务器虚拟成多个虚拟服务器,每个虚拟服务器拥有独立的操作系统、IP地址、内存等资源,在虚拟主机上搭建多个网站,可以降低服务器成本,提高资源利用率。

具体操作步骤如下:

(1)选择合适的VPS服务商,购买VPS服务。

(2)根据服务商提供的管理面板,创建多个虚拟主机。

(3)将域名解析到VPS服务器的IP地址。

(4)上传网站文件到虚拟主机,配置网站相关信息。

2、虚拟主机扩展(Node.js、Python等)

一台服务器如何搭建多个网站,深入解析,一台服务器如何高效搭建多个网站

对于使用Node.js、Python等语言开发的网站,可以使用虚拟主机扩展功能,在同一台服务器下搭建多个网站。

具体操作步骤如下:

(1)选择支持Node.js、Python等语言的虚拟主机服务商。

(2)购买虚拟主机服务,并开通扩展功能。

(3)根据服务商提供的管理面板,配置网站相关信息。

(4)上传网站文件到虚拟主机,配置网站相关信息。

3、服务器集群

服务器集群是将多台物理服务器通过高速网络连接在一起,形成一个整体,在服务器集群中,每台服务器可以独立处理请求,提高网站性能和稳定性。

具体操作步骤如下:

(1)选择合适的物理服务器,并搭建高速网络。

(2)在每台服务器上安装操作系统、数据库、应用程序等。

(3)配置负载均衡器,将请求分发到不同的服务器。

(4)将域名解析到负载均衡器的IP地址。

一台服务器如何搭建多个网站,深入解析,一台服务器如何高效搭建多个网站

4、虚拟化技术(Docker)

虚拟化技术可以将应用程序及其运行环境封装在一个容器中,实现跨平台部署,使用Docker技术,可以在同一台服务器下搭建多个网站,提高资源利用率。

具体操作步骤如下:

(1)在服务器上安装Docker。

(2)编写Dockerfile,定义应用程序的运行环境。

(3)构建Docker镜像,并启动容器。

(4)将域名解析到服务器的IP地址。

注意事项

1、资源分配:合理分配服务器资源,避免单个网站占用过多资源,影响其他网站性能。

2、安全防护:加强服务器安全防护,防止恶意攻击,确保网站安全稳定运行。

3、数据备份:定期备份数据,以防数据丢失。

4、监控与维护:对服务器和网站进行实时监控,及时处理故障,保证网站正常运行。

在同一台服务器下搭建多个网站,可以有效提高资源利用率,降低服务器成本,本文介绍了虚拟主机、虚拟主机扩展、服务器集群和虚拟化技术等几种搭建方法,希望对大家有所帮助,在实际操作过程中,根据网站需求和服务器性能选择合适的方法,确保网站安全、稳定、高效运行。

黑狐家游戏

发表评论

最新文章